Sie sind auf Seite 1von 4

1.

Determine cul de los siguientes tipos de datos numricos son verdaderos, si


es vlida especifique si es entero o real:
a) 0.5

d) 12345678

g) 0515

b) 237,822

e) 12345678L

h) 018CDF

c) 9.312

f) -12587

i) 0x87

a) 0.5 Si es vlido, es un nmero real.


b) 237,822 No es vlido, si este fuera un nmero real, debera cambiar la
coma por un punto quedara de este modo (237.822) ese punto indicara
que es un decimal.
c) 9.312 Si es vlido, es un nmero real.
d) 12345678 Si es vlido y es un nmero entero.
e) 12345678L No es vlido, ya que contiene una letra, en dado caso de que
sea una variable numrica generara error.
f) -12587 Si es vlido y es un nmero entero
g) 0515 Si es vlido y es un nmero entero as el nmero no tenga un
orden especifico no tiene parte decimal.
h) 018CDF No es vlido, ya que contiene letras, en dado caso de que sea
una variable numrica generara error.
i) 0x87 al igual que el anterior, no es vlido ya que contiene letras.

*Los nmeros enteros y los reales son muy similares pero podemos
diferenciarlos porque enteros no tienen parte decimal y los nmeros
reales permiten cualquier tipo de fraccin decimal que termina,
peridica o no peridica.

2. Determine cul de los siguientes tipos de datos de carcter son vlidos:


a) a

d) \\

g) \0

b) $

e) \a

h) XYZ

c) /n

f) T

i) \052

a) a Es un caracter vlido
b) $ El caracter es vlido
c) /n El caracter no es vlido
d) \\ El caracter no es vlido
e) \a El caracter no es vlido
f) T Es un caracter vlido
g) \0 No es un caracter vlido
h) XYZ No es un caracter vlido
i) \052 No es un caracter vlido
*Los caracteres no vlidos, son incorrectos ya que en medio de dos
apostrofes solo puede haber un carcter, en caso de /n la funcin debe
estar en medio de (), \a no cumple con la regla y adicional a eso es
incorrecto el \ su uso correcto sera /a para usar el sonido de la
campana, \0, XYZ, \052 no son vlidos ya que cada uno se debe
separar con apostrofes cada una.

3. Determine cul de los siguientes tipos de datos de cadenas de carcter


son vlidos:

a)

8:15 P.M.

b)

Rojo, Blanco, Azul

c)

Nombre:

d)

Capitulo 3 (Cont \d)

e)

1.3e-12

f)

New York, NY 2000

g)

El maestro dijo, por favor respeten a sus compaeros

a) No es vlido, para representar una cadena se utilizan las comillas.


b) Es vlida.
c) No es vlida.
d) Es vlida.
e) Es vlida
f) Es vlida
g) No es vlida.

*Las respuestas que no son vlidas se fundamentan en que para


representar una cadena siempre se deben utilizar las comillas () en el
caso de 8:15 P.M. se utilizaron apostrofes, Nombre: no cerro las
comillas y eso inmediatamente generara un error, El maestro dijo, por

favor respeten a sus compaeros podemos ver que efectivamente la


frase por favor respeten a sus compaeros tiene sus comillas
correspondientes pero el inicio de esta El maestro dijo,() no tiene
ningn cierre.

4. Cul es la salida del siguiente programa?


#include <iostream>
Main ( )
{
// cout << Hola maestro\n;
}

*No tiene ninguna salida, ya que el // indica que es un comentario, al


imprimir en pantalla simplemente saldra Oprima una tecla para
continuar.

5. Qu entrada se genera en el siguiente programa?


#include<iostream>
Main( )
{
cin >> V1 >> V2;
cin >> Precio_venta;
}
*No tendra ninguna salida porque simplemente se nombraron las
variables, ms no se les ha asignado un valor o alguna funcin.

Das könnte Ihnen auch gefallen